Mengapa SVG Adalah Pilihan Yang Lebih Baik Untuk Grafik Animasi Di Web
Diterbitkan: 2023-02-12Dalam hal menganimasikan grafik di web, dua format file yang paling populer adalah GIF dan SVG. Meskipun keduanya bagus untuk tujuan masing-masing, ada beberapa perbedaan utama di antara keduanya. Misalnya, GIF dibatasi hingga 256 warna, sedangkan SVG dapat mendukung hingga 16 juta warna. GIF juga dibatasi dengan lebar dan tinggi maksimum 256 piksel, sedangkan SVG tidak memiliki batasan seperti itu. Selain itu, GIF adalah gambar raster, artinya dibuat dari kisi-kisi piksel. Ini dapat membuatnya tampak buram atau berpiksel saat diperbesar atau diperkecil. SVG, di sisi lain, adalah gambar vektor, artinya mereka terdiri dari persamaan matematika yang dapat diskalakan tanpa batas tanpa kehilangan kualitas apa pun. Jadi, apa artinya semua ini bagi Anda? Nah, jika Anda ingin membuat grafik animasi untuk web, taruhan terbaik Anda adalah menggunakan file SVG . Tidak hanya akan terlihat lebih baik, tetapi juga jauh lebih serbaguna dan fleksibel.
Setiap elemen dalam template HTML5 dasar disertakan dalam editor HTML, terlepas dari apakah Anda menulisnya di codepen atau di editor HTML. CSS dapat diterapkan ke Pena Anda dari halaman web mana pun yang menggunakannya. Prefiks properti dan nilai sering digunakan untuk meningkatkan dukungan lintas-browser. Untuk menggunakan Pena Anda, cukup klik skrip yang ingin Anda gunakan dari mana saja di Internet. Harap masukkan URL di sini, lalu tambahkan sesuai urutan yang Anda miliki di JavaScript di Pena. Jika skrip yang Anda tautkan memiliki ekstensi file dengan preprosesor, kami akan mencoba memprosesnya sebelum mendaftar.
Saya khawatir hal itu tidak mungkin dilakukan. GIF adalah gambar bitmap yang dianimasikan dengan setiap piksel memiliki definisi unik, sedangkan SVG adalah file vektor yang menentukan semua objek dalam gambar (garis, bentuk) berdasarkan definisi matematis.
Grafik SVG bersarang dimungkinkan melalui format SVG . Elemen “svg>” dapat ditempatkan di dalam elemen “svg>” lainnya. Tidak ada penempatan mutlak dalam sarang; sebaliknya, elemen yang akan ditempatkan adalah elemen induk “*svg”.
Gambar yang disimpan dalam file SVG dapat disimpan lebih efisien daripada gambar yang disimpan dalam format raster standar jika gambar tidak terlalu detail. file bitmap berisi lebih banyak informasi daripada file SVG, yang menampilkan vektor dalam skala apa pun; namun, file bitmap berisi lebih banyak piksel daripada file SVG, yang menghabiskan lebih banyak ruang.
Apakah Svg Mendukung Gif?
Tidak, SVG tidak mendukung GIF.
SVG adalah proyek yang disusun pada akhir 1990-an dan sebagian besar diabaikan pada sebagian besar tahun 2000-an. Semua browser web modern dapat merender file SVG, dan sebagian besar program menggambar vektor mengekspornya. Grafik dirender di browser melalui bentuk, angka, dan koordinat daripada menggunakan kisi piksel. Akibatnya, ini tidak hanya bebas resolusi, tetapi juga dapat diskalakan. Gif telah ada selama yang saya ingat, dan terus menjadi populer hingga hari ini. Karena GIF adalah masalah besar dalam ruang gambar, GIF tidak efisien dan kuno. Karena hanya menggunakan palet warna sebanyak 256 warna, gambar yang dibuat dapat terlihat lebih buruk dibandingkan dengan file gambar lainnya.
Gambar GIF adalah biner, dengan setiap piksel mewakili posisi hidup atau mati. Akibatnya, transisi antara warna latar depan dan latar belakang menjadi lebih sulit. Jika Anda bermaksud menggunakan gambar/ikon Anda pada latar belakang non-putih, Anda harus memahami hal ini. Selain itu, kemampuan untuk menganimasikan SVG langsung dari kode serta mengontrol banyak, banyak atributnya, menambah tingkat kerumitan yang sama sekali baru.
Apakah File Svg Mendukung Animasi?
Hasilnya, dengan kemampuan untuk mengubah grafik vektor dari waktu ke waktu, Anda dapat membuat efek animasi menggunakan SVG. Seperti halnya format file lainnya, Anda dapat menganimasikan konten SVG dengan cara berikut. Elemen animasi SVG [animasi-svg] dapat digunakan untuk membuat jenis grafik ini. Variasi elemen dokumen dapat dijelaskan dalam hal waktu saat menggunakan fragmen dokumen SVG.
Bisakah Anda Membuat Gif Menjadi Svg?
Ini dapat digunakan untuk menyimpan gambar GIF sebagai gambar vektor, dan dapat dibuka di dalamnya. Sangat mudah untuk mengedit gambar GIF sebelum mengonversinya.
Apakah Svg Lebih Baik Daripada Gif?
Selain skalabilitas, independensi resolusi, dan ukuran file kecil, kemampuan warna dan transparansi membuatnya lebih baik daripada GIF. Mari kita lihat GIF terlebih dahulu. GIF, yang telah ada selama beberapa dekade, pada awalnya dirancang untuk gambar kecil atau loop pendek atau video foto.
Bagaimana Saya Menyematkan Gambar Di Svg?
Ada beberapa cara untuk menyematkan gambar di svg:
1. Gunakan elemen 'gambar' dan setel atribut 'xlink:href' ke jalur gambar.
2. Gunakan elemen 'foreignObject' dan setel atribut 'xlink:href' ke jalur gambar.
3. Gunakan elemen 'svg:image' dan setel atribut 'xlink:href' ke jalur gambar.
Elemen Img Dari Html
Elemen gambar di SVG, seperti elemen img di HTML, dimaksudkan untuk melayani tujuan yang sama. Anda dapat menggunakannya untuk menghasilkan gambar raster (atau vektor) arbitrer. File PNG, JPEG, dan Scalable Vector Graphics (SVG) semuanya didukung oleh spesifikasi. Konten tersemat adalah konten yang ditambahkan ke dokumen setelah diimpor dari sumber lain. Konten tersemat dapat didukung menggunakan gambar *SVG. Elemen SVG dapat disematkan langsung ke halaman HTML Anda.
Bisakah Anda Menempatkan Gif di Tag Img?
Saat menggunakan tag IMG SRC= animation1 , misalnya, Anda dapat memasukkan animasi GIF ke HTML. Tag IMG harus diikuti dengan tag.
Gif Di Dalam Svg
Itu elemen di dalam sebuah
Filter Svg Seperti Filter Css, Tetapi Untuk Elemen Svg
Selanjutnya, Anda dapat menggunakan filter SVG, yang mirip dengan filter CSS, kecuali diterapkan pada elemen sva. Filter blur, drop shadow, dan glow adalah tiga filter SVG yang paling populer .
Gambar Ke Svg
Gambar ke SVG adalah proses di mana gambar raster diubah menjadi gambar vektor. Ini dapat dilakukan dengan menggunakan perangkat lunak yang mendukung format SVG, seperti Adobe Illustrator. Prosesnya biasanya melibatkan pelacakan gambar dan pembuatan jalur vektor dari piksel. Setelah jalur dibuat, jalur tersebut dapat disimpan sebagai file SVG.
Scalable Vector Graphics (SVG) menggambarkan vektor dua dimensi dan grafis campuran dimensi dan Turing dalam XML. File teks biasa, bukan file biner, adalah jenis file. Editor teks biasa atau editor XML dapat digunakan untuk membaca dan mengedit grafik SVG. Prosesor XSL-FO saat ini tidak mendukung SVG. Prosesor XSL-FO berbasis Java seperti XEP dapat menggunakan katalog XML untuk memetakan URL DTD SVG ke file lokal untuk memetakan URL. Meskipun elemen tersemat bukan standar HTML , beberapa browser merespons dengan lebih baik. Jika Anda tidak memiliki browser yang mendukungnya, Anda mungkin ingin mempertimbangkan untuk menggunakan versi bitmap dari grafik apa pun untuk keluaran HTML.
Encapsulated PostScript (EPS) adalah format file pilihan untuk grafik vektor sebelum pengenalan Grafik Vektor. EPS dapat dirender menggunakan PostScript, tetapi diperlukan juru bahasa PostScript untuk melakukannya. Standar baru, yang dikenal sebagai SVG, bekerja dengan baik dengan keluaran XSL-FO dan PDF dan merupakan standar terbuka. Jika Anda memiliki banyak file EPS, Anda dapat dengan mudah mengubahnya menjadi. File VNG menggunakan Adobe Illustrator atau pstoedit.
Dengan menggunakan konverter online kami, Anda dapat dengan mudah mengonversi gambar dalam format file populer apa pun menjadi file SVG, apakah itu JPEG, PNG, atau jenis file lainnya. Format file SVG adalah format file serbaguna yang dapat digunakan untuk berbagai keperluan, termasuk ilustrasi, logo, dan grafik. Dengan pengonversi online kami, Anda dapat mengubah gambar apa pun menjadi format file .VSV tanpa harus bersusah payah mengonversinya secara manual.
Mengapa Svg Merupakan Format Gambar Terbaik Untuk Kita
Ini adalah format gambar berbasis vektor yang bekerja dengan baik di Internet. File JPEG dan file PNG, di sisi lain, jauh lebih mahal untuk diproduksi, seperti halnya file SVG. Perusahaan juga memberikan transparansi yang penting untuk gambar dan logo yang harus ditampilkan secara online.
Embed Png Di Svg
File SVG dapat berisi gambar raster, seperti file PNG. Ini disebut "menyematkan." Untuk menyematkan PNG dalam SVG: 1. Temukan file PNG yang ingin Anda gunakan. 2. Di editor SVG Anda, buka panel "Gambar". 3. Seret file PNG ke panel "Gambar". 4. Di panel "Properties", atur "Width" dan "Height" agar sesuai dengan ukuran file PNG. 5. Di panel "Lapisan", seret file PNG di bawah lapisan vektor. Sekarang file PNG disematkan di file SVG Anda!
Untuk menampilkan logo perusahaan atau gambar lain yang relevan, Anda harus menyertakan gambar yang relevan saat membuat layar HMI. Gambar biasanya disimpan sebagai file PNG atau JPEG dalam banyak kasus. Saat gambar (JPEG/PNG) disematkan dalam file a.sva, gambar tersebut disimpan sebagai gambar tersemat. Akibat peningkatan ukuran file SVG ini, Ecava IGX mungkin tidak dapat memuat HMI dengan benar. Sebelum menyalin gambar ke folder proyek, langkah pertama adalah membuat folder bernama 'PROJECT_FOLDER/images/.' Pada Langkah 2, Anda akan menarik dan melepas gambar raster ke file SAGE menggunakan Inkscape (unduh di sini). Pilih Tautan dari menu tarik-turun dan gambar akan ditambahkan sebagai gambar tautan. Jika Anda menginginkan gambar berskala, gunakan Blocky untuk mengoptimalkan kinerja pemuatan file SVG.
Itu Elemen Svg
Karena elemen image memungkinkan elemen untuk menyertakan dan merender bitmap, elemen ini dapat digunakan untuk menyisipkan dan menampilkannya dalam objek SVG . Anda juga dapat menyisipkan gambar dalam format JPEG, PNG, dan .VNG.